MIL-PRF-55681 PART NUMBER ORDERING INFORMATION
CDR01 B P 101 B K S M
STYLE & SIZE CODE
STYLE
C — Ceramic
D — Dielectric, Fixed Chip
R — Established Reliability
RATED TEMPERATURE
–55°C to +125°C
DIELECTRICS
P —± 30 PPM/°C—WITH OR WITHOUT VOLTAGE
X —± 15%—without voltage
+ 15%, –25%—with voltage
CAPACITANCE
Expressed in picofarads (pF).
First 2 digits represent significant figures and the last digit specifies the number of zeros to follow.
(Use 9 for 1.0 through 9.9pF. Example: 2.2pF = 229)
FAILURE RATE LEVEL (%/1000 hrs.)
M — 1.0 R — 0.01
P — 0.1 S — 0.001
TERMINATION FINISH
S — Solder Coated, Final
(SolderGuard I)
U — Base Metalization—
Barrier Metal—Solder
Coated (SolderGuard I)
W — Base Metalization—
Barrier Metal—Tinned
Tin or (Tin/Lead Alloy)
SolderGuard II
Y — Base Metalization
Barrier Metal—Tinned
(100% Tin) Solderguard II
CAPACITANCE TOLERANCE
B C DFJ KM
±.1 pF ±.25 pF ±.5 pF ±1% ±5% ±10% ±20%
RATED VOLTAGE
A — 50; B — 100
KEMET/MIL-PRF-55681 PART NUMBER EQUIVALENTS
C 0805 P 101 K 1 G M C*
CERAMIC
SIZE CODE
See Table Above
SPECIFICATION
P -MIL-PRF-55681 = CDR01-CDR06
N-MIL-PRF-55681 = CDR31-CDR35
CAPACITANCE CODE
Expressed in picofarads (pF).
First two digits represent significant figures.
Third digit specifies number of zeros. (Use 9
for 1.0 thru 9.9 pF. Example: 2.2 pF –229)
CAPACITANCE TOLERANCE
B C DF J KM
±.1 pF ±.25 pF ±.5 pF ±1% ±5% ±10% ±20%
END METALIZATION
C — SolderGuard II (Military equiv: Y, W)
H — SolderGuard I (Military equiv: S, U)
FAILURE RATE (%/1,000 hrs.)
M — 1.0 R — 0.01
P — 0.1 S — 0.001
VOLTAGE TEMPERATURE CHARACTERISTIC
Designated by Capacitance
Change Over Temperature Range
G — BP (C0G/NP0) (±30 PPM/°C)
X — BX (±15% Without Voltage
+15% -25% With Voltage)
VOLTAGE
1 — 100V, 5 — 50V
* Part Number Example: C0805P101K1GMC (14 digits - no spaces)
